Regular Cleaning Techniques

When it comes to maintaining our Basin for Pedicute™ and Simplicity, regular cleaning is essential for ensuring hygiene and performance.

We should start by filling the basin with warm water and a mild, non-abrasive cleaner to gently scrub the interior. It’s crucial to pay attention to any corners or crevices where residue may build up.

After scrubbing, we can rinse thoroughly to remove any soap residue. Given the removable design, we can easily take the basin out for cleaning, making the process much simpler.

Remember to dry it completely before storing. By following these techniques, we’ll keep our basin looking great and functioning at its best, enhancing the overall pedicure experience for our clients.

Recommended Cleaning Products

Choosing the right cleaning products is essential for maintaining our Basin for Pedicute™ and Simplicity.

Using the appropriate cleaners not only preserves the glass’s clarity but also extends its lifespan. Here’s what we recommend:

  1. pH-Neutral Cleaner: This gentle solution effectively removes dirt and grime without damaging the glass surface.

  2. Microfiber Cloths: These are perfect for wiping down the glass, as they’re soft and non-abrasive, ensuring no scratches occur.

  3. Glass Cleaner: Opt for an ammonia-free formula to avoid any harsh chemicals that could harm the basin’s finish.

Preventing Scratches and Damage

Maintaining the pristine appearance of our Basin for Pedicute™ and Simplicity goes beyond just using the right cleaning products.

To prevent scratches and damage, we should always use soft cloths or microfiber materials when cleaning. Avoid abrasive sponges or harsh scrubbers, as they can easily mar the surface.

Additionally, let’s be mindful of placing heavy objects on the glass; using coasters or mats can help distribute weight and protect the surface.

When moving items around, it’s best to lift them rather than dragging them across the glass.

Finally, we can create a dedicated space for tools and products to prevent accidental bumps or scratches.

Addressing Stains and Discoloration

Although stains and discoloration can be frustrating, we can effectively tackle these issues with the right approach.

To restore our basin glass to its original beauty, let’s follow these three steps:

  1. Use a Gentle Cleaner: We should choose a pH-balanced cleaner specifically designed for glass surfaces to avoid damaging the finish.

  2. Soft Cloth Application: Let’s use a microfiber cloth to gently buff the area, ensuring we don’t scratch the surface while removing stains.

  3. Regular Spot Treatment: We must address spills and stains immediately, as letting them sit can lead to permanent discoloration.

Routine Inspection and Maintenance

After addressing stains and discoloration, we need to focus on the importance of routine inspection and maintenance for our basin glass.

Regular checks help us catch any potential issues early, preventing costly repairs down the line. Let’s inspect for cracks, chips, or loose fittings at least once a month.

We should also clean the glass thoroughly to avoid buildup that can compromise its integrity. If we notice any signs of wear or damage, let’s address them immediately.

Additionally, maintaining the seals and connections can enhance the lifespan of our basin glass.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can I Use Vinegar for Glass Basin Cleaning?

We can definitely use vinegar for glass basin cleaning! It cuts through grime and leaves a streak-free shine. Just remember to rinse well afterward, so we don’t leave any residue behind. Happy cleaning!

How Often Should I Polish My Glass Basin?

We recommend polishing your glass basin at least once a month. This keeps it looking clear and vibrant, and helps prevent buildup. Regular care guarantees it remains a stunning focal point in your space.

Is It Safe to Use Abrasive Cleaners?

We wouldn’t recommend using abrasive cleaners on glass surfaces. They can scratch and damage the finish. Instead, we prefer gentle, non-abrasive solutions to maintain the beauty and integrity of our glass items.

What Should I Do if My Basin Chips?

If our basin chips, we should assess the damage immediately. We can consider professional repair services or, if necessary, explore replacement options to maintain the aesthetic and functionality of our space. Let’s act promptly!

Can Hard Water Affect Glass Basin Appearance?

Yes, hard water can affect our glass basin’s appearance. It can leave unsightly mineral deposits, which we should regularly clean to maintain clarity and shine, ensuring our basin continues looking beautiful and inviting.
